This is not simply a line-cook position with a management title. Our Sous Chef works directly alongside our Executive Chef and plays a hands-on leadership role in daily kitchen production, team coordination, recipe development and standardization, inventory and waste management, quality control, catering preparation, and the systems that keep a growing production kitchen running efficiently. The right person will be equally comfortable cooking, leading a team, solving problems, and sitting down at a computer to work through production numbers, recipes, costing, schedules, or operational systems. What You'll Do Lead Daily Kitchen Production Help organize and oversee daily kitchen prep and production. Prioritize, sequence, and delegate work across the kitchen team. Monitor production throughout the day and adjust when priorities change. Step in and cook/prep alongside the team whenever needed. Maintain high standards for quality, consistency, portioning, presentation, food safety, and timeliness. Help lead kitchen operations when the Executive Chef is unavailable. Lead & Develop the Team Communicate expectations clearly and professionally. Train, coach, and direct kitchen and juicing staff. Hold the team accountable to recipes, systems, sanitation standards, production goals, and timelines. Help create an organized, productive kitchen culture where people know what is expected of them. Manage Production Systems Maintain and update production and prep schedules. Track production numbers and help establish appropriate pars. Oversee special orders, recurring fulfillment programs, and production deadlines. Maintain organized walk-ins, coolers, freezers, and storage areas using proper labeling, dating, rotation, and FIFO practices. Monitor waste and identify opportunities to improve purchasing, preservation, utilization, and efficiency. Recipes, Costing & Quality Control Refine and standardize recipes for flavor, texture, yield, portioning, consistency, and nutrition. Identify and correct recipe-yield discrepancies. Assist with food costing, yield calculations, AP-to-EP conversions, portion/net-weight documentation, and macronutrient calculations. Conduct ongoing quality-control checks. Maintain awareness of allergen safety and applicable food-labeling standards. Help identify opportunities to improve quality while controlling food cost and waste. Menus, Catering & Culinary Development Assist with monthly meal-prep menu development. Help plan catering menus, including custom events. Prepare catering requisitions, production plans, and firing schedules. Support costing and labor planning for catering events. Participate in recipe R&D and new-product development as the company continues to grow. Schedule This is primarily a Monday-Friday daytime position, approximately 6:00 AM-2:00 PM.
